Clark Boylan 94a1562763 Write fedora download redirect info to stderr
This will allow us to debug potentially bad fedora download backend
locations that don't provide valid subreleases in file paths. To do this
we ask curl to write headers (-i) and then dump the headers (-D) to
stderr. This should keep the debug info out of the parsing path for
subrelease info.

README.rst

fedora

Use Fedora cloud images as the baseline for built disk images. For further details see the redhat-common README.

Releases

This element targets the current and previous version of Fedora; these values clearly changes over time. To fix the version set the DIB_RELEASE variable to the Fedora version (e.g. 36). The default value is the current best supported version (i.e. it may change upward at any given release to support the next Fedora).

Environment Variables

DIB_DISTRIBUTION_MIRROR:
Required

No

Default

None

Description

To use a Fedora Yum mirror, set this variable to the mirror URL before running bin/disk-image-create. This URL should point to the directory containing the releases/updates/development and extras directories.

Example

DIB\_DISTRIBUTION\_MIRROR=http://download.fedoraproject.org/pub/fedora/linux
